Concrete retaining wall installation involves constructing durable structures designed to hold back soil and prevent erosion on sloped or uneven land. These walls are typically built using precast or poured concrete, offering strength and stability to support landscaping features, terraced gardens, or property boundaries. Skilled contractors prepare the site, lay a solid foundation, and carefully assemble the concrete segments or pour the concrete to ensure the wall’s longevity and effectiveness. Proper installation is key to ensuring the wall can withstand environmental pressures and remain functional over time.

This service helps address common problems related to soil erosion, land shifting, and landscape instability. Without proper support, slopes can become prone to washing out during heavy rains, leading to property damage or safety hazards. Retaining walls also create level areas for outdoor living spaces, gardens, or driveways, making sloped properties more functional and visually appealing. By controlling soil movement and preventing erosion, these walls protect the integrity of landscaping and foundational structures, reducing long-term maintenance needs.

Properties that typically benefit from concrete retaining wall installation include residential homes with uneven yards, hillside properties, and properties with significant changes in elevation. These walls are often used to create terraced gardens, define property lines, or support driveways and walkways. Commercial properties, parks, and public spaces may also utilize concrete retaining walls to manage land contours and improve safety. Overall, any property that faces challenges with soil stability or requires a level outdoor area can be a candidate for this type of construction.

The overview below groups typical Concrete Retaining Wall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or concrete retaining wall repairs range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es fall within this range, depending on the extent of damage and materials needed.

Standard Installation - Installing a new concrete retaining wall usually costs between $3,000 and $7,000. Most projects in this category are mid-sized and fall within this range, though larger or more complex jobs can be higher.

Large or Custom Projects - Larger, more complex concrete retaining wall installations can range from $8,000 to $15,000 or more. These projects often involve custom designs, difficult terrain, or additional features, which can push costs higher.

Full Replacement - Replacing an existing retaining wall entirely typically costs between $10,000 and $20,000. Many service providers handle projects in this range, with higher costs for extensive or highly specialized work.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are concrete retaining walls used for? Concrete retaining walls are used to hold back soil, prevent erosion, and create level areas in landscaping or construction projects.

Are there different types of concrete retaining walls? Yes, there are various types such as poured concrete, precast panels, and gravity walls, each suitable for different applications and site conditions.

How do local contractors ensure the stability of a concrete retaining wall? They assess soil conditions, design appropriate reinforcement, and follow proper construction techniques to ensure the wall's stability and durability.

What factors influence the choice of a concrete retaining wall? Factors include the height of the wall, soil type, load requirements, and aesthetic preferences, which local service providers can help evaluate.

Can concrete retaining walls be customized to match landscape designs? Yes, local contractors can incorporate various finishes, textures, and design elements to complement the surrounding landscape.
